Transaction 1254ff76c62afc76d22b8c3ec251347bff6b882ee6cb3ed5ed44095ebca71ae5

1 Input
1 Outputs
  • 1254ff76c62afc76d22b8c3ec251347bff6b882ee6cb3ed5ed44095ebca71ae5:0
  • value  311421
    address  39WtXTwfAbkeEFAHDfXeHDSkTtAGHpdSJP